On 15/03/2022 23:02, Patrick ALLAERT wrote:
I am not against the fact this warning becomes an error per se. I am just
not very fan of cherry-picking an individual kind of problem (read:
notice/warning/error/...) and changing it without a more global frame.

I think we should try to hit all of them, ideally in time for PHP 9.

That was the premise behind: https://externals.io/message/116918

It will likely take several RFCs until we've got it in the state we want it, some of those are more contentious than others (such as undefined array indexes).

I think undefined property access should throw too, and will likely have supermajority support, but let's do it in a separate RFC.

What I don't think we want is the entire package being blocked because a particular item (i.e. array keys) is contentious.
